It was Club Day at PJHS on Wednesday! As part of the Military Prep Club, students got a glimpse into what boot camp is like by watching different aspects of Army basic training. Afterward, they took time to write heartfelt letters to Mrs. Kuyper’s son, Isaac, who is currently going through basic training. We’re proud of their curiosity, dedication, and support for one of our own! 🇺🇸✉️

Coach Raymond would like to thank Roland tires for sending Matt and Adam out to work with our 7th and 8th grade leadership classes. They learned how to change a tire, asked many questions about the business and found out some of the skills and requirements for a career in this field. Everyone buys tires! Thank you Roland tires for giving to our community!
